The Polysorbate 40 Market is experiencing consistent growth, fueled by its extensive use as an emulsifier, stabilizer, and dispersing agent across food, pharmaceuticals, and cosmetics. Over 48% of food processing companies utilize polysorbate 40 for maintaining texture and stability in products such as baked goods, dairy, and confectioneries. Its multifunctional role makes it a vital ingredient in industrial and consumer applications.

Cosmetics and Personal Care Applications
In the cosmetics industry, around 42% of skincare and haircare formulations include polysorbate 40 for its emulsifying properties. It ensures smooth product texture and stability in creams, lotions, and shampoos, aligning with consumer demand for high-performance personal care products.

Rising Demand for Clean-Label Ingredients
With growing consumer preference for clean-label and safe additives, polysorbate 40 is gaining wider acceptance due to its regulatory approval and safety profile. More than 40% of manufacturers highlight it as a preferred emulsifier that balances performance with compliance to food and drug safety standards.
